Big-box retailers can't sell an appliance at full price once the box is opened or the panel is marked, so they clear those units by the truckload. That's where our stock comes from — the discount is about how the appliance looks, not what it does.

The two grades you'll see on our listings

Brand New – Scratch & Dent

Never used. It left the retailer's warehouse with a cosmetic mark — a dent in a side panel, a scuffed door, a scratch on the finish — so it can't be sold at full price. Everything inside is untouched.

Like New – Scratch & Dent

A customer return or floor unit with cosmetic wear. It may have been installed briefly or sat on a showroom floor. Same cosmetic-only standard, at the lower of our two price bands.

Every listing shows its grade, the manifest item number, our price and the retailer's price side by side. Nothing is hidden behind a vague "as-is" label.

What gets tested — and what doesn't

What we check

Refrigerators and freezers get plugged in and run until we can confirm they cool. That's the check we do ourselves, and it's the one that matters most on a used-appliance purchase.

What we don't check

We don't test water lines, ice makers or other features, and we don't test dishwashers or ranges at all. Being straight about that is part of why the price is what it is.

Why that's still safe

Every appliance we sell carries a 1-year warranty through our warranty partner CPS (Consumer Priority Service). If something fails in normal use, you file with CPS and it's handled — you're not arguing with a liquidation seller.

Where to buy scratch & dent appliances near Bellingham

There aren't many scratch and dent appliance stores in Whatcom County. Most people end up choosing between a big-box clearance corner, a used appliance store with second-hand units, and a liquidation outlet like this one selling brand new and like-new appliances with cosmetic marks. The difference matters: a used appliance has already spent years in a kitchen, while most of our stock has never been installed.
